Window jumps toward the screen's bottom right in Mac

Description

Hi, I am using a 15.4" MacBook Pro with Mac OSX Tiger (2.33 GHz Intel Core 2 Duo), running FileZilla 3.0.1 (from the Intel .dmg). Here are the contents of the "About FileZilla" window:
host: i686-apple-darwin8
Build date: 2007-09-19
Compiled with: i686-apple-darwin8-gcc--4.0.1
(GCC) 4.0.1 (Apple Computer, Inc. build 5250)
(GCC) 4.0.1 (Apple Computer, Inc. build 5250)
Compiler flags: -g -O2 - Wall -g -fexceptions

Anyway, whenever a dialog box comes up, such as when I click on the "Open the Site Manager" button, the main FileZilla window jumps toward the bottom right of the screen such that the upper left quadrant of the window ends up in the lower right part of the screen. (The dialog box shows up with its top left corner roughly aligned with the now-relocated main window. If I click the "Open the Site Manager" box again, without relocating it back to its normal place, the window completely disappears off the screen, though this time the dialog box's bottom right corner is flush into the bottom right corner of the screen.
